Spligitty Fiber, a division of AFL Global, is seeking an experienced Splicer II to support fiber optic network construction, maintenance, and restoration projects. The Splicer II is responsible for performing fusion splicing, testing, troubleshooting, and documentation of fiber optic cable systems in a data center, outdoor and indoor environments. This role requires a strong understanding of fiber optic technologies, network infrastructure, and safety practices while working independently or as part of a construction team.
The ideal candidate will have experience working in OSP and ISP fiber environments and possess the technical skills necessary to ensure high-quality fiber installations that meet customer and project specifications.
Responsibilities
~1 min read- →Perform fusion splicing of single-mode and multi-mode fiber optic cables.
- →Prepare and splice fiber optic cables in aerial, underground, and indoor environments.
- →Install, maintain, and troubleshoot fiber optic infrastructure.
- →Conduct OTDR, power meter, and loss testing to verify network performance and integrity.
- →Interpret fiber design documents, splice schematics, and network drawings.
- →Complete fiber optic testing documentation and as-built records accurately.
- →Locate, diagnose, and repair fiber network outages and service disruptions.
- →Install and organize fiber panels, patch panels, splice closures, and distribution cabinets.
- →Ensure all work is completed according to customer specifications, project requirements, and industry standards.
- →Maintain company-issued vehicles, tools, test equipment, and splicing trailers.
- →Assist with emergency restoration activities, including after-hours support when required.
- →Coordinate with construction crews, foremen, project managers, and customers to ensure project success.
- →Support project closeout activities, including final documentation and quality assurance reviews.
- →Follow all AFL Global, Spligitty Fiber, OSHA, and customer-specific safety requirements.
